After flying high against Utopia last Monday, Falls City came back down to earth. The Falls City Beavers fell just short of the Blanco Panthers by a score of 43-40 on Tuesday.
Multiple players turned in solid performances to lead Blanco to victory, but perhaps none more so than Ashton Uballe, who went 8 for 15 en route to 20 points plus seven rebounds and two steals. Another player making a difference was Kaylee Romero, who went 6 for 15 en route to 18 points plus four steals.
Falls City's defeat ended a ten-game streak of away wins dating back to last season and brought them to 5-5. As for Blanco, their win (their first of the season) made their record 1-3.
